Separate and Merge multiple PSDs, keeping large file easy to manage

   04 Jan 10   

Once a while, your PSD can be very large in size. Sometimes, it's inevitable due to size of the project. Then we are kind of in a dillema. In one hand, you want to keep everything in one place, so that any change can be shown in all layers. In the other hand, one large PSD can be intimidatingly slow.

One of my favorite trick is to split the PSDs to several files, and accessing them separately while designing, while keeping one main file of PSD that contains all the latest update of the layers.

To separate PSD, the easiest way is to

  • Delete all uneeded layers
  • Save that particular layer in another name

To combine PSD :

  • Open both files
  • select the layers/groups in the child you want to move to the main PSD, press CTRL for selecting multiple layers and group
  • and drag the selected layers to the main PSD
  • TIPS: use SHIFT while drag the layers to the main PSD, it will automatically center it and save you effort to position the layers
